You should have enough observations in your data set to be able to find the mean of the quantitative dependent variable at each combination of levels of the independent variables.īoth of your independent variables should be categorical. Planting densities 1 and 2 are levels within the categorical variable planting density. Fertilizer types 1, 2, and 3 are levels within the categorical variable fertilizer type. A level is an individual category within the categorical variable. It can be divided to find the average bushels per acre.Ī categorical variable represents types or categories of things. Bushels per acre is a quantitative variable because it represents the amount of crop produced. You can use a two-way ANOVA when you have collected data on a quantitative dependent variable at multiple levels of two categorical independent variables.Ī quantitative variable represents amounts or counts of things.
